Our Leaders

Our General Overseer And Founder Is Reverend Dr Paul Jinadu.
Our National Overseer For The United Kingdom Is Reverend Dele Amusan.

Rev Paul Jinadu and Mummy Kate Jinadu

General Overseer And Founder

Revd. Jinadu was born a Muslim in Lagos, Nigeria. He became a Christian after Jesus appeared to him and abandoned his pursuit of medical education in the United Kingdom.

He went to The Bible College of Wales, Swansea, in 1962, and later also studied theology at The London Bible College, where he graduated in 1972.

Rev Dele & Rev (Mrs) Bishop Amusan

National Overseer For The United Kingdom

Reverend Dele Amusan has been in church leadership since 1982. He and his wife, Rev’d (Mrs) Bisi Amusan have pastored different branches of New Covenant Church since 1991. Whilst pastoring the New Covenant Church, Deptford branch, Dele was also the National Administrator of the church until 1996. In 1989, Bisi co-founded the church’s children ministry.
